Specifications
Series: SaRonix-eCera™ JT
Packaging: Tape & Reel (TR) 
Part Status: Active
Base Resonator: Crystal
Type: TCXO
Frequency: 16.369MHz
Function: --
Output: Clipped Sine Wave
Voltage - Supply: 2.8V
Frequency Stability: ±500ppb
Operating Temperature: -30°C ~ 85°C
Current - Supply (Max): 1.5mA
Ratings: --
Mounting Type: Surface Mount
Package / Case: 4-SMD, No Lead
Size / Dimension: 0.098" L x 0.079" W (2.50mm x 2.00mm)
Height - Seated (Max): 0.032" (0.80mm)
